  • ZOU Lamei

 

Lamei ZOU is currently an associate professor of the School of Artificial Intelligence and Automation, Huazhong University of Science and Technology, Wuhan, P.R. China. She is now a member of the image processing Lab. of HUST. Her research interests focus on image contour detection, image classification, image video 3D Depth-Map estimation, image quality evaluation and machine learning. She has published in the areas of image classification, image quality evaluation, image processing algorithm evaluation, and image simulation, etc.
